Market Opportunity
Enforce style and safety guardrails for long-running coding agents targets a $6.0B = 2M engineering teams × $3K ACV total addressable market with medium saturation and a year-over-year growth rate of 25% annual growth driven by rapid adoption of AI developer tooling and agent orchestration platforms (Source: Gartner and McKinsey aggregate estimates on AI developer tool adoption).
Key trends driving demand: Developer adoption of autonomous agents is accelerating — more teams run long-running agent workflows that create drift and inconsistent outputs, creating demand for enforcement.; Shift from single-query LLMs to multi-step agent orchestration — this complexity exposes gaps that monitoring and correction tools can address.; Enterprises are demanding auditability and governance for AI systems — tools that provide logs, rule enforcement, and policy controls are becoming procurement priorities..
Key competitors include Guardrails (open-source), LangChain, AgentOps.
